  • Patent number: 4973272
    Abstract: An electrical socket assembly is provided with contactors (50,51, FIG. 3) lying in a pin-receiving hole, which provides a high withdrawal force for the pin (31). Each contactor is of the type that includes a pair of circular bands and a plurality of inwardly-bowed beams extending between the bands to resiliently contact the pin. The assembly includes two of such contactors lying in tandem in the socket hole, to more uniformly guide the pin along the hole, and provide low contact resistance and a high resistance to withdrawal for a pin of given diameter. The socket includes two internal grooves (82,84) that each hold one contactor, and an intermediate wall (80) between the grooves that prevents the contactors from riding up on one another to jam the pin in the hole.

  • Patent number: 4906211
    Abstract: A socket assembly is provided at the end of a heavy electrical cable which includes sockets designed to be pushed into connection with pins on an aircraft, to pass current between them, which provides low resistance to avoid heating while also providing a high withdrawal force to prevent the weight of the cable end from pulling it out of connection with the aircraft pins. The sockets include pin-receiving holes, with grooves in the hole walls for holding multi-beam contactors. Each contactor includes a pair of spaced circular bands and a plurality of beams extending between the bands and bowed radially inwardly to resiliently contact the pin. A socket includes two of such contactors, whose beams engage the plug at two locations spaced along the hole to more uniformly guide the pin along the hole and provide low contact resistance and a high resistance to withdrawal. The contactors are initially plastically deformed when the pin is first inserted, to assure that a high withdrawal force is achieved.

  • Patent number: 4828225
    Abstract: An apparatus is provided for use at an airport for drawing in and paying out an electric cable, which reliably grips the cable even when it is covered with a slippery anti-freeze fluid used at airports. The apparatus includes a motor-driven traction wheel against which the cable is pressed, with the periphery of the wheel being concave and having a radius of curvature about the same as the cable so the cable can closely nest in it. The wheel has closely spaced treads that press through fluid on the cable to grip it, and has a circumferentially extending groove through which fluid can drain. The cable is pressed against the wheel by rollers that have concave peripheries to also closely surround the cable.

  • Patent number: 4739129
    Abstract: An electrical box is provided at the outer end of an electrical power cable of the type that supplies power to aircraft parked at an airport, which enables rapid replacement of damaged switches in a compact and watertight arrangement. The electrical box includes a main connector assembly which has a plurality of conductor socket terminals connected to conductors in the cable, and a switch assembly which includes a plurality of switches. The switch assembly fits into a recess in the main housing, and includes projecting pins connected to the switches and which are received in corresponding conductor socket terminals on the main housing. Not only can switches be easily replaced, but the arrangement avoids the need for a bulky connection box where wires of switches are connected to free lengths of the conductors. The switch assembly includes a circular projection from which the pins project, the circular projection including a sealing ring which seals to a corresponding circular recess in the main housing.

  • Patent number: 4053173
    Abstract: A bicycle of the type comprising a frame and a front and rear wheel rotatably mounted to the frame is provided with improved means for rotatably driving the rear wheel. The driving means comprises a right and left foot lever pivotally connected at one end to the frame and adapted to be alternately depressed by the feet of the bicyclist. Each foot lever is coupled by a link to a pivot rod pivotally connected to the frame so that the alternate depression of the foot levers rotates the pivot rod between a first and a second rotational position. A radial torque lever is secured to the pivot rod and coupled by a third link member to a radial torque lever on the rear wheel driving means.
